Native range 36 botanical countries
| Region | TDWG code | Continent |
|---|---|---|
| Amur | AMU | ASIA-TEMPERATE |
| Buryatiya | BRY | |
| China North-Central | CHN | |
| China South-Central | CHC | |
| Chita | CTA | |
| Inner Mongolia | CHI | |
| Iran | IRN | |
| Japan | JAP | |
| Khabarovsk | KHA | |
| Korea | KOR | |
| Krasnoyarsk | KRA | |
| Kuril Is. | KUR | |
| Manchuria | CHM | |
| Mongolia | MON | |
| North Caucasus | NCS | |
| Primorye | PRM | |
| Qinghai | CHQ | |
| Taiwan | TAI | |
| Tibet | CHT | |
| Transcaucasus | TCS | |
| Türkiye | TUR | |
| Austria | AUT | EUROPE |
| Belgium | BGM | |
| Bulgaria | BUL | |
| Czechia-Slovakia | CZE | |
| France | FRA | |
| Germany | GER | |
| Greece | GRC | |
| Italy | ITA | |
| NW. Balkan Pen. | YUG | |
| Romania | ROM | |
| Switzerland | SWI | |
| Ukraine | UKR | |
| East Himalaya | EHM | ASIA-TROPICAL |
| Nepal | NEP | |
| West Himalaya | WHM |
Not drawn on the map: Kuril Is.. We hold no public-domain boundary for this region, so it is listed rather than guessed at.
Region boundaries approximated from Natural Earth (public domain) and mapped to TDWG World Geographical Scheme for Recording Plant Distributions (WGSRPD) level-3 botanical countries (Brummitt 2001). Indicative, not the official WGSRPD geometry.
Also published as 26 synonyms
A synonym is not an error. It is a record of botanists disagreeing, in print, about where this plant belongs. Each of these was somebody’s considered answer.
- Bernhardia helvetica (L.) Gray
- Diplostachyum helveticum (L.) P.Beauv.
- Diplostachyum radicans (Schrank) P.Beauv.
- Heterophyllium helveticum (L.) Börner
- Lepidotis radicans (Schrank) P.Beauv.
- Lycopodioides helvetica (L.) Kuntze
- Lycopodioides mariesii (Baker) Kuntze
- Lycopodium helveticum L.
- Lycopodium radicans Schrank
- Selaginella helvetica f. heliophila Dalla Torre
- Selaginella helvetica f. umbrosa Dalla Torre
- Selaginella helvetica subsp. banatica Gand.
- Selaginella helvetica subsp. caucasica Gand.
- Selaginella helvetica subsp. curvula Gand.
- Selaginella helvetica subsp. dacica Gand.
- Selaginella helvetica subsp. demota Gand.
- Selaginella helvetica subsp. hackelii Gand.
- Selaginella helvetica subsp. insubrica Gand.
- Selaginella helvetica subsp. istriaca Gand.
- Selaginella helvetica subsp. jucunda Gand.
- Selaginella helvetica subsp. laeta Gand.
- Selaginella helvetica subsp. legitima Gand.
- Selaginella helvetica subsp. similis Gand.
- Selaginella helvetica var. vera Sandford
and 2 more.
